package amneziawg import ( "fmt" amneziatun "github.com/amnezia-vpn/amneziawg-go/tun" "github.com/qdm12/gluetun/internal/wireguard" ) // createTUN creates a TUN device. When gso is false, IFF_VNET_HDR is // omitted so amneziawg-go's initFromFlags sees no vnet header support and // keeps tun.vnetHdr=false, falling back to simple single-packet writes instead // of the GRO/GSO batch path that causes EINVAL on some vendor kernels. func createTUN(name string, mtu int, gso bool) (amneziatun.Device, error) { //nolint:ireturn if gso { return amneziatun.CreateTUN(name, mtu) } tunFile, err := wireguard.OpenTUNFile(name) if err != nil { return nil, fmt.Errorf("creating tun fd file: %w", err) } tunDevice, err := amneziatun.CreateTUNFromFile(tunFile, mtu) if err != nil { return nil, fmt.Errorf("creating TUN device from file: %w", err) } return tunDevice, nil }
